Floating point argument passed integer
WebIts purpose is to manipulate the bits of floating-point numbers. A float is stored in 32 bits divided into sign, exponent and mantissa. The code uses bitwise operators to manipulate the bits, for example, float_half () cuts a floating-point number in half by subtracting 1 from the exponent. It works like this: WebArgument is passed as unsigned int, but it is to be interpreted as the bit-level representation of a single-precision floating point value. sk Anything out of range (including Nan and infinity) should return 0x80000000u. Legal ops: Any integer/unsigned This problem has been solved!
Floating point argument passed integer
Did you know?
WebFeb 20, 2016 · The float value is passed in float registers, while the int value is passed in the conventional parameter stack. So when the values are referenced, they are fetched from different areas and it magically works, even though is shouldn't (and won't, on a different box). Share Improve this answer Follow answered Aug 27, 2014 at 21:41 Hot Licks WebMar 30, 2024 · Float() is a method that returns a floating-point number for a provided number or string. Float() returns the value based on the argument or parameter value …
WebThere are also integer variants which read the second operand as an integer from memory. Floating-point function arguments. Because the ABI requires that normal floating point arguments be passed in the xmm registers, it takes some work to get them into the FP stack. We have to move them into memory (typically, local space allocated on the ... WebSubmitted by Pablo Hernández Assigned to Nobody Link to original bugzilla bug (#1761) Version:...
Webint isAsciiDigit ( int x) { int sign = 1 << 31; int upperBound = ~ (sign 0x39 ); /*if > 0x39 is added, result goes negative*/ int lowerBound = ~ 0x30; /*when < 0x30 is added, result is negative*/ /*now add x and check the sign bit for each*/ upperBound = sign & (upperBound+x) >> 31; lowerBound = sign & (lowerBound+ 1 +x) >> 31; WebYou need to pass each of the score variables as arguments to the function. - Add a comment indicating that the program is displaying the result - Call the displayResult(l) function and pass the calculated average to it as an argument. - return a successful status to the OS - It is now time to create stubs for each of our functions.
WebThese operators perform mathematical calculations on arguments of integer and floating point type. When the operators are applied to variables of field type, the value, timestamp and quality is calculated as follows. Value - Calculated using the operator and the 2 arguments. timestamp - The latest timestamp of the 2 arguments are used
WebC floor () function: floor ( ) function in C returns the nearest integer value which is less than or equal to the floating point argument passed to this function. ”math.h” header file supports floor ( ) function in C language. Syntax for floor ( ) function in C is given below. double floor ( double x ); income tax slabs ay 20-21Web6. Use any floating point data types, operations, or constants. NOTES: 1. Use the dlc (data lab checker) compiler (described in the handout) to: check the legality of your solutions. 2. Each function has a maximum number … income tax slabs australiaWebFeb 11, 2024 · A complex floating-point number, or a structure containing just one complex floating-point number, is passed as though it were a structure containing two floating-point reals. Variadic arguments And after a variadic argument has been passed on the stack, all future arguments will also be passed on the stack, i.e., the last … income tax slabs for ay 21-22Webpassed in integer register ai. However, floating-point arguments that are part of unions or array fields of structures are passed in integer registers. Additionally, floating-point … income tax slabs 2022-23 tableWebJul 3, 2024 · Because the options weaken what is considered a valid floating point (and a valid integral) when going between Lua and C++. If you want to be strict in all your … income tax slabs as per old schemeWebThese rules may say that parameters of certain types are passed in certain registers (e.g., integer types in general registers and floating-point types in separate floating-point registers), that large arguments (such as structures with many elements) are passed … inchcape shipping bristolWeb* Both the argument and result are passed as unsigned int's, ... * * The unsigned value that is returned should have the identical bit * representation as the single-precision floating-point number 2.0^x. * If the result is too small to be represented as a denorm, return * 0. If too large, return +INF. inchcape shipping cairns